GKMinMaxStrategist.GetRandomMove(IGKGameModelPlayer, nint) 方法
定义
重要
一些信息与预发行产品相关,相应产品在发行之前可能会进行重大修改。 对于此处提供的信息,Microsoft 不作任何明示或暗示的担保。
返回最佳移动之间的 numMovesToConsider
随机移动。
[Foundation.Export("randomMoveForPlayer:fromNumberOfBestMoves:")]
public virtual GameplayKit.IGKGameModelUpdate GetRandomMove (GameplayKit.IGKGameModelPlayer player, nint numMovesToConsider);
abstract member GetRandomMove : GameplayKit.IGKGameModelPlayer * nint -> GameplayKit.IGKGameModelUpdate
override this.GetRandomMove : GameplayKit.IGKGameModelPlayer * nint -> GameplayKit.IGKGameModelUpdate
参数
- player
- IGKGameModelPlayer
- numMovesToConsider
- System.System.IntPtr System.nativeint
返回
- 属性
注解
如果 RandomSource 为 null
,则此方法返回与 相同的移动 GetBestMove(IGKGameModelPlayer)。